CVE-2022-4215

February 23, 2023 by godfreyd94

The Chained Quiz pl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Reflected Cross-Site Scripting via the ‘date’ parameter on the ‘chainedquiz_list’ page in versions up to, and including, 1.3.2.3 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that execute if they can successfully trick a user into performing an action such as clicking on a link.

CVE-2022-4216

February 23, 2023 by godfreyd94

The Chained Quiz pl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the ‘facebook_appid’ parameter in versions up to, and including, 1.3.2.2 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ers with administrative privileges to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page.

The Login with Cognito WordPress plugin through 1.4.8 does not sanitise and escape some of its settings, which could allow high privilege users such as admin to perform Stored Cross-Site Scripting attacks even when the unfiltered_html capability is disallowed (for example in multisite setup).
